Melbourne Beach man identified as pilot killed in Clearwater plane crash

The 3 victims that were killed in a plane crash in Clearwater last Thursday have been identified.

According to reports from WFLA, they were 54-year-old Melbourne Beach pilot Jemin Patel and two others, 54-year-old Mary Ellen Ponder from Treasure Island and 68-year-old Martha Parry from Clearwater. Patel was the only occupant of the plane.

Patel took off in his Beechcraft Bonanza V35 from Vero Beach Regional Airport, about 15 miles north of Fort Pierce, and was heading to Clearwater Airpark, according to data from FlightRadar24.

Around 7p.m. Thursday, Patel reported he experienced engine failure before crashing into the mobile home park. The crash set several of the homes on fire, and killing the other 2 victims. The crash was about 3 miles north of the runway at Clearwater Airpark

Federal authorities are investigating the crash.
